A brand-new kind of ultraviolet light that might be secure for people took much less than five mins to reduce the level of interior airborne microorganisms by greater than 98%, a joint research study by researchers at Columbia University Vagelos University of Physicians and Surgeons and in the U.K. has actually discovered. Also as microbes proceeded to be splashed into the area, the level stayed really low as long as the lights got on.


But previously these studies had actually just been conducted in little speculative chambers, not in full-sized rooms imitating real-world problems. In the existing research, researchers at the University of St. Andrews, University of Dundee, University of Leeds, and Columbia College examined the efficacy of far-UVC light in a large room-sized chamber with the exact same air flow price as a typical office or home (regarding 3 air changes per hour).


The efficacy of different techniques to lowering interior infection degrees is generally measured in terms of equivalent air changes per hour. In this study, far-UVC lamps created the equivalent of 184 comparable air exchanges per hour. This exceeds any type of various other technique to decontaminating busy interior areas, where 5 to 20 comparable air modifications per hour is the very best that can be accomplished virtually.

The major parameters of UV-C disinfection are wavelength, dosage, relative moisture, and temperature. There is no consensus about their optimum worths, but, in general, light at a high dose and a range of wavelengths having 260 nm is favored in a setting at room temperature level with low loved one humidity. This light can be created by mercury-vapour, light-emitting diode (LED), pulsed-xenon, or excimer lamps.


Additionally, there are wellness and safety and security dangers related to the UV-C modern technology when made use of in the distance of people. UV-C disinfection systems have appealing features and the possible to enhance in the future. However, explanations surrounding the various parameters influencing the modern technologies' effectiveness in medical facility atmosphere are required. For that reason UV-C sanitation need to presently be taken into consideration for low-level rather than high-level sanitation.


One more application emerged in 1910 when UV light was used to sanitize water. Nonetheless, the technology was not extremely dependable at the time and it took additionally technological developments prior to UV water sanitation became prominent once more in the 1950s [ 2] Nowadays, UV light is made use of for water, air, food, surface, and medical equipment disinfection.

DNA, RNA, or proteins of a micro-organism soak up UV light, with a peak absorbance around 260 nm [6] This leads to the disruption of DNA or RNA, leading to the inactivation of the micro-organism. UV-C-induced DNA disturbance commonly includes the bonding of two adjoining thymine (or cytosine) bases rather than the standard linking of a base with its complementary base on the other strand.

After UV-C irradiation, micro-organism repair service can happen, resulting in a lowered last inactivation by partially turning around the stimulated interruption after irradiation. Repair mechanisms can be partitioned into 2 courses, namely photoreactivation and dark repair, of which the initial type has the biggest effect.


The UV-C area is used for disinfection however there is no agreement on the specific optimum wavelength. Light at 260 nm can cause the most disruption. Different micro-organisms are most prone to a little various wavelengths.
